Kilejas
Kilejas is a surname of likely Baltic origin. While its precise etymology is subject to interpretation, it is commonly believed to be derived from the Lithuanian word "kilti," meaning to rise, ascend, or originate. This suggests a possible connection to ancestral lineage, social standing, or geographical origin. The surname is predominantly found in Lithuania and among the Lithuanian diaspora in countries such as the United States, Canada, and Australia. Historical records indicate its presence in various regions of Lithuania, particularly in areas with a strong Lithuanian cultural identity. Variations in spelling may exist across different historical documents and geographical locations. Individuals bearing the Kilejas surname have contributed to diverse fields, including academia, arts, business, and public service. The cultural significance of the surname is tied to the broader history and traditions of the Lithuanian people.
